Volleyball Recap: Kenai Central Kardinals vs. Soldotna Stars
Kenai Central faced Soldotna in a battle between two of the state's top teams on Friday. The Kardinals fell 2-0 to the Stars. The Kardinals were not able to repeat the success they had when they faced the Stars earlier this season, when they won 1-0.
Sophie Tapley paced Kenai Central's offense, picking up four kills. Tapley got some help from Gracee Every and her eight assists. Tapley also made an impact serving: she shared the team lead in aces with Mia Settlemyer, each putting up two.
Kenai Central's loss dropped their record down to 29-10-5. As for Soldotna, they have been performing well recently as they've won three of their last four contests. That's provided a nice bump to their 22-13 record this season.
Kenai Central didn't take long to hit the court again: they've already played their next match, a 2-0 win against North Pole on the 24th. As for Soldotna, they have also already played their next matchup, a 2-0 defeat against Chugiak on the 25th.
